  1. In my opinion physical cores are what categories should be based on for CPU, it's easier to compare. Right now old CPUs without HT are in the same category in HWBot as CPU with HT, for instance i5 2500k & i7 2600k are both in the 4 cores category. Hyper-threading is a feature, like AVX 512 for instance, so I don't think it should matter to sort categories. If a 16 cores CPU with big/little cores is slower than a "real" 16 cores CPU in the rankings, so be it. So my choice is option #2, because it's consistent with the way results are sorted in the database nowadays.
  2. Yes it does. I got my first bios working again flashing this chip with an EVC2SX. Here is the link to the SPI header's pinout, but the EVC2SX uses 2,54mm pitch, while the asus header uses 2.0mm pitch. but nothing a bit of DIY can't fix SPI-header pinouts – Forum – ElmorLabs A big thanks to Elmor for being patient and helping me out with this on his Discord server ❤️
